🌟Python3:轻松判断素数🌟
2025-03-28 02:59:52
•
来源:
导读 在编程的世界里,素数是一个非常有趣的数学概念!那么如何用Python3来判断一个数是否是素数呢?下面给大家分享一个小技巧👇。首先,什么是...
在编程的世界里,素数是一个非常有趣的数学概念!那么如何用Python3来判断一个数是否是素数呢?下面给大家分享一个小技巧👇。
首先,什么是素数?简单来说,素数就是大于1且只能被1和它本身整除的自然数,比如2、3、5、7等都是素数。那么问题来了,如何编写代码来判断一个数是不是素数呢?
我们可以利用循环和条件语句来实现这个功能。以下是一个简单的Python代码示例:
```python
def is_prime(n):
if n <= 1:
return False
for i in range(2, int(n0.5) + 1):
if n % i == 0:
return False
return True
测试一下
number = 17
if is_prime(number):
print(f"{number} 是素数 🎉")
else:
print(f"{number} 不是素数 😔")
```
这段代码的核心在于通过`for`循环从2到`sqrt(n)`检查是否存在能整除`n`的数。如果存在,则说明`n`不是素数;否则,它是素数。这种方法既高效又实用,非常适合初学者学习和实践。快试试吧!✨
版权声明:转载此文是出于传递更多信息之目的。若有来源标注错误或侵犯了您的合法权益,请作者持权属证明与本网联系,我们将及时更正、删除,谢谢您的支持与理解。
关键词: